18445829 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 18445830. Its totient is φ = 18445828.
The previous prime is 18445813. The next prime is 18445841. The reversal of 18445829 is 92854481.
It is a strong prime.
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 15288100 + 3157729 = 3910^2 + 1777^2 .
It is an emirp because it is prime and its reverse (92854481) is a distict pr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 18445829 - 24 = 18445813 is a prime.
It is a Chen prime.
It is equal to p1177979 and since 18445829 and 1177979 have the same sum of digits, it is a Honaker prime.
It is a congruent number.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(18445849) by changing a digit.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(11)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 9222914 + 9222915.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(9222915).
